Comprehensive Guide to Scoring Guide

What is the Creative Writing Scoring Guide?

The Creative Writing Scoring Guide serves as an evaluation template designed to assist educators in assessing creative writing projects. It is specifically tailored for grading the story "The Ransom of Red Chief," providing a structured approach to writing assessment. This guide helps ensure a consistent evaluation process, allowing teachers to clearly communicate expectations to students and maintain transparency in grading.

Purpose and Benefits of the Creative Writing Scoring Guide

The primary purpose of the Creative Writing Scoring Guide is to streamline the grading process for creative writing assignments. By providing clear criteria for evaluating various elements such as design, characterization, content, and mechanics, it supports objective assessment. This enables educators to offer constructive feedback, helping students understand their strengths and areas for improvement.
